你有没有想过,你的安卓手机里那些神奇的app是怎么和你的串口设备沟通的呢?没错,就是通过安卓系统app调用串口这个神奇的技术!今天,就让我带你一探究竟,揭开这个神秘的面纱。
串口通信,了解一下?

首先,得先弄明白什么是串口通信。简单来说,串口通信就是通过串行接口进行数据传输的一种方式。它就像两个人拉着手,一个字一个字地传递信息。在电脑和外部设备之间,串口通信是一种非常常见的数据传输方式。
安卓系统app调用串口,究竟是怎么回事?

那么,安卓系统app是如何调用串口的呢?这得从安卓系统的底层说起。安卓系统是基于Linux内核的,而Linux内核本身就支持串口通信。所以,安卓系统app调用串口,其实就是通过Linux内核提供的串口驱动程序来实现的。
调用串口,需要哪些步骤?

想要让安卓系统app调用串口,一般需要以下几个步骤:
1. 获取串口设备信息:首先,你需要知道你的设备上有哪些串口,以及它们的设备文件路径。比如,常见的串口设备文件路径是/dev/ttyS0或/dev/ttyUSB0。
2. 打开串口设备:通过系统API,打开对应的串口设备文件。这个过程就像打开一扇门,让app可以和串口设备进行通信。
3. 配置串口参数:设置串口的波特率、数据位、停止位、校验位等参数。这些参数就像串口通信的规则,决定了数据传输的速度和格式。
4. 读写数据:通过串口设备文件,进行数据的读写操作。这个过程就像两个人通过串口通信,一个字一个字地传递信息。
5. 关闭串口设备:完成通信后,关闭串口设备文件,释放资源。这个过程就像关上一扇门,结束通信。
调用串口,有哪些注意事项?
在调用串口的过程中,还有一些注意事项:
1. 权限问题:在安卓系统中,访问串口设备需要相应的权限。如果你的app需要调用串口,需要在AndroidManifest.xml文件中申请相应的权限。
2. 串口驱动:确保你的设备上安装了正确的串口驱动程序。如果没有安装,可能会导致无法调用串口。
3. 串口设备状态:在调用串口之前,确保串口设备处于正常状态。如果串口设备出现故障,可能会导致通信失败。
4. 串口通信稳定性:在开发过程中,要注意串口通信的稳定性。可以通过测试代码,确保app能够稳定地调用串口。
:安卓系统app调用串口,其实并不复杂
通过以上介绍,相信你已经对安卓系统app调用串口有了基本的了解。其实,这个过程并不复杂,只需要掌握一些基本的步骤和注意事项,你就可以轻松实现安卓系统app与串口设备的通信。
那么,接下来,你打算用这个技术做些什么呢?是开发一个智能家居app,还是控制一个机器人?不管怎样,安卓系统app调用串口这个技术,都能为你提供强大的支持。让我们一起,探索这个神秘的世界吧!